Natural Supplements for Stress Management: What the Evidence Shows
Chronic stress is more than a feeling — it is a measurable physiological state that affects cortisol levels, immune function, sleep architecture, digestive health, and cardiovascular risk. While stress management fundamentally depends on lifestyle strategies (sleep, exercise, time management, therapy), certain supplements have demonstrated the ability to modulate the body's stress response in clinical research. The key is knowing which ones have real evidence and which are riding on marketing alone.
The Stress Response System: A Quick Primer
The hypothalamic-pituitary-adrenal (HPA) axis is the body's central stress response system. When the brain perceives a threat, the hypothalamus signals the pituitary gland, which signals the adrenal glands to release cortisol and adrenaline. This system evolved for short-term survival responses. When activated chronically by modern stressors (work pressure, financial concerns, information overload), it can lead to HPA axis dysregulation — manifesting as persistent anxiety, fatigue, sleep disruption, cognitive fog, and metabolic changes.
The supplements in this guide work through various mechanisms: some modulate HPA axis reactivity, others support neurotransmitter production, and some address the downstream consequences of chronic stress like inflammation and oxidative damage. Adaptogens: The Most Researched Stress Supplements
Adaptogens are a class of herbs that, by definition, help the body resist and adapt to stressors. The concept originated in Soviet pharmacology research in the 1940s. Modern research has validated some — though not all — adaptogenic claims.
| Adaptogen | Research Dose | Key Finding | Evidence Level | Important Caution |
|---|---|---|---|---|
| Ashwagandha (KSM-66, Sensoril) | 300-600mg/day | Multiple RCTs show 23-30% cortisol reduction; significant anxiety and stress score improvements | Moderate-Strong | Stimulates thyroid; rare liver injury; avoid in pregnancy |
| Rhodiola rosea | 200-600mg/day (3% rosavins, 1% salidroside) | Reduced mental fatigue and improved stress resilience in multiple controlled trials | Moderate | Mild stimulant; take in AM; avoid with bipolar medication |
| Holy Basil (Tulsi) | 300-600mg/day | Small studies show improvements in anxiety, stress, and sleep scores | Preliminary | May have anti-fertility effects; limited long-term data |
| Bacopa monnieri | 300-450mg/day (bacosides) | Primarily cognitive, but also reduces anxiety and cortisol in stressed individuals | Moderate (for cognition); Preliminary (for stress) | GI side effects common; takes 8-12 weeks for full effect |

Non-Adaptogen Stress Support Supplements
Magnesium — Often called “nature's relaxation mineral,” magnesium modulates the HPA axis, regulates GABA receptor function, and supports nervous system relaxation. Subclinical deficiency — estimated to affect half of American adults — can amplify stress reactivity, muscle tension, and sleep difficulty. Multiple meta-analyses suggest magnesium supplementation may reduce subjective anxiety, particularly in individuals with low baseline intake. L-Theanine — An amino acid found predominantly in green tea, L-theanine promotes alpha brain wave activity — the relaxed-but-alert state associated with meditation. Studies using 200-400mg show reductions in stress-related biomarkers and subjective anxiety without sedation. It appears to work within 30-60 minutes, making it useful for acute stress situations. L-theanine is generally considered very safe, with no known significant drug interactions at standard doses.
Omega-3 fatty acids — A 2018 meta-analysis in JAMA Network Open encompassing 19 clinical trials and over 2,200 participants found that omega-3 supplementation was associated with reduced anxiety symptoms, particularly at doses above 2,000mg EPA+DHA daily. The mechanism likely involves anti-inflammatory effects on the brain and modulation of neurotransmitter function.
B vitamins — The B vitamin complex supports neurotransmitter synthesis (serotonin, GABA, dopamine), energy metabolism, and methylation — all of which are relevant to stress resilience. Several clinical trials have shown that B vitamin supplementation reduces subjective work stress, mental fatigue, and tension. Effects are most pronounced in individuals with marginal B vitamin status, which is common under chronic stress (stress increases B vitamin utilization). Phosphatidylserine — A phospholipid that is a component of cell membranes, phosphatidylserine (PS) has been studied for its ability to blunt the cortisol response, particularly to exercise-induced and acute psychological stress. Several small studies show cortisol reduction at doses of 400-800mg/day. Evidence is preliminary and limited to specific stress contexts.
Sleep-Related Stress Supplements
Stress and sleep have a bidirectional relationship — stress impairs sleep, and poor sleep amplifies stress reactivity. Supplements targeting this intersection include:
- Magnesium glycinate or threonate — supports GABA activity and muscle relaxation; taken 1-2 hours before bed
- L-Theanine — may improve sleep quality without sedation when taken 30-60 minutes before bed
- Melatonin (low-dose, 0.5-3mg) — supports circadian rhythm alignment rather than acting as a sedative; most useful for disrupted sleep schedules, jet lag, or shift work
- Tart cherry extract — a natural source of melatonin and anti-inflammatory polyphenols; small studies show modest improvements in sleep duration and quality
What This Is NOT For
The TotalHealthRD Editorial Team wants to be clear: supplements for stress management are supportive tools — they are not treatments for clinical anxiety disorders, depression, PTSD, or other mental health conditions. These conditions require professional evaluation and evidence-based treatment, which may include psychotherapy, medication, or both. If stress symptoms significantly impair daily functioning, relationships, or work performance, please seek evaluation from a mental health professional.
Supplements should also not replace foundational stress management practices: regular exercise, adequate sleep, social connection, time in nature, and therapeutic support when needed.
Safety Considerations for Stress Supplements
Several stress supplements interact with medications commonly prescribed for anxiety and mood disorders:
- Ashwagandha and Rhodiola — may interact with thyroid medications, sedatives, and immunosuppressants
- L-Theanine — may potentiate blood pressure-lowering medications
- Omega-3s (high-dose) — additive effects with blood thinners

Building a Stress Management Supplement Protocol
- Establish lifestyle foundations first — these have stronger evidence than any supplement
- Address nutritional deficiencies (magnesium, B vitamins, vitamin D, omega-3s) — deficiency amplifies stress vulnerability
- Choose ONE well-researched adaptogen (ashwagandha or rhodiola) based on your specific stress pattern — ashwagandha for anxiety-dominant stress; rhodiola for fatigue-dominant stress
- Add L-theanine for acute stress situations or daily calm without sedation
- Support sleep quality with magnesium glycinate and good sleep hygiene
- Reassess after 8 weeks — if no meaningful improvement, consider whether root causes have been adequately addressed
